Free fermions and WZW theories on nonsimple groups

We consider conformally and Kac-Moody invariant theories based on the groups G = G(N) x G(N tilde) where G(N) is any of the classical groups. For the values k = N tilde, k tilde = N of the Kac-Moody central charges, the monodromy problem involved in the computation of the four point function for primary fields in the defining representation of G possesses two distinct solutions. As a consequence, the WZW theory on G (with an addition U(1) factor if G(N) = SU(N)) cannot be equivalent to a theory of free fermions. (orig.)
